Which of the following species is regionally extinct in India?

AnswerClick to flip back
A
Indian Cheetah
💡 Explanation:

The Indian Cheetah (Acinonyx jubatus venaticus) is a subspecies of cheetah that was once found in India. However, it is now considered to be regionally extinct in the country.
